• PalmOne's just-announced Tungsten E2 is the successor to one of my favorite PDAs, the Tungsten E. The "big" news is the addition of Bluetooth--yawn. Once again PalmOne is pushing the technology nobody wants instead of the one everyone does: Wi-Fi. But the addition of non-volatile RAM is a huge plus. A lot of people simply don't "get" that if you don't keep your PDA charged, your data goes bye-bye. NVR eliminates that problem.
